Frequently Asked Questions about East Linden

How much are Studio apartments in East Linden?

There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in East Linden with rent ranges from $1,200 to $1,295 with an average price of $1,256.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om East Linden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in East Linden ranges from $750 to $2,082 with an average monthly rent of $1,108.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in East Linden c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in East Linden range from $850 to $3,018.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,419.

How expensive are East Linden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 32 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in East Linden on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,075 to $3,360 - averaging $1,634 for the location.
